Dashboard link: https://claude-vs-codex-dashboard.vercel.app/

I built a dashboard analyzing the sentiment between Claude Code and Codex on Reddit comments. The analysis searched for comments comparing Claude Code vs Code then used Claude Haiku to analyze the sentiment, and which model was preferred. It also lets you filter by various categories such as speed, workflows, problem-solving, and code quality. You can also weight by upvotes to make the comparison by upvotes rather than raw comment numbers.

Takeaways:

* Codex wins on sentiment (65% of comments prefer Codex, 79.9% of upvotes prefer Codex).

* Claude Code dominates discussion (4× the comment volume).

* GLM (a newer Chinese player) is quietly sneaking into the conversation, especially in terms of cost

* On specific categories, Claude Code wins on speed and workflows. Codex won the rest of the categories: pricing, performance, reliability, usage limits, code generation, problem solving, and code quality.
